Here we have a very cool Ibanez UE-405 multi-effects unit, previously owned by Tom Verlaine! This rackmount effect features a compressor/limiter, stereo chorus, parametric EQ and an analog delay all in one box. It also has an effects loop and is fully footswitchable. What’s cool about these is that you can set the order of each effect in the chain, including where the effects loop is positioned. The unit shows wear and signs of use, but it functions correctly and sounds fantastic. The stereo feature run with dual tube amps is simply phenomenal. Included are the UE-405 and footswitch, as well as a letter of provenance from a previous retailer.
